TITLE: GCN CIRCULAR NUMBER: 43558 SUBJECT: GRB 260127B: Swift-XRT observations DATE: 26/01/29 15:59:58 GMT FROM: Phil Evans at U of Leicester D.N. Burrows (PSU), S. Lanava (PSU), S. Dichiara (PSU), J.P. Osborne (U. Leicester), K.L. Page (U. Leicester), S. Campana (INAF-OAB), A. Melandri (INAF-OAR), T. Sbarrato (INAF-OAB) and P.A. Evans (U. Leicester) reports on behalf of the Swift-XRT team: Swift-XRT has performed follow-up observations of the Fermi/GBM-detected burst GRB 260127B (The Fermi GBM team, GCN Circ. 43533), collecting 985 s of Photon Counting (PC) mode data between T0+70.4 ks and T0+71.4 ks. No X-ray sources have been detected consistent with the tentative GOTO optical afterglow candidate (O’Neill et al, GCN Circ. 43538). The 3-sigma upper limit in the field ranges from ~0.01 to ~0.02 ct s^-1, corresponding to a 0.3-10 keV observed flux of 5.0e-13 to 6.9e-13 erg cm^-2 s^-1 (assuming a typical GRB spectrum).
